The Drone Warfare Market is growing at a steady rate of 13.47% in the forecast period due to the increasing use of drones in security and surveillance and the growing technological advancement. The advancement of using drones in security and surveillance plays a significant role in the drone technology market because of the exhibited developments. Most contemporary drones come with updated high-definition cameras, night vision, thermal imaging, or similar gadgets that can capture videos and images regardless of the lighting conditions. These features make drones fast and effective and enable the ability to get live feed and real-time information that is very useful in security along the borders, as well as big functions and functions of patrolling large perimeters. Thus, the example below illustrates the growing adoption of drones in security and surveillance.

In 2024, the Telangana police will deploy high-end surveillance drones in the state's border regions as part of their effort to ramp up security in areas affected by insurgencies. These advanced drones were used mostly in the Line of Control (LOC) and the Line of Actual Control (LAC). The drones can cover an area with a radius of 25 km and are equipped with night-vision capabilities.

In 2024, the Security agencies of Mumbai and Goa plan to implement drone surveillance systems to bolster maritime security. This comes due to a recent incident where three individuals from Kuwait reached the Gateway of India, underscoring vulnerabilities in the current coastal security setup.

Based on the capability, the drone warfare market is segmented into platform, services, software, ground control stations, drone launch and recovery systems. The platform segment acquired a majority share in the market due to its core functionality and versatility. The platform segment includes physical drones as it provides the core functionality for numerous military applications. Additionally, growing technological advancements in drone technology have significantly enhanced the capabilities of platforms. Several improvements have been made to drone platforms to increase their durability, stealth features, payload capacity, and integration with advanced sensors and communication systems to make them more effective and attractive for defense uses. Thus, recent events illustrate this, for instance, the acquisition of MQ-9B SkyGuardian drones by Taiwan in 2024 for the reconnaissance function. Further, the work of Northrop Grumman in developing a hybrid electric drone also reflects the shift towards sustainability and the military's multi-operational drones which define a new horizon of drone platform.

Based on the mode of transportation, the drone warfare market is bifurcated into semi-autonomous and autonomous. The semi-autonomous segment dominated the market in 2023 and is expected to behave in the same fashion in the forecast period. The major factors contributing to the growth include operational control and human oversight, growing technological maturity and reliability, and the deployment of semi-autonomous drones by integrating into the existing military infrastructure. Military operations require real-time decision-making based on complex, rapidly changing circumstances. In combat scenarios, where ethical considerations and rules of engagement are crucial, these drones allow human operators to maintain oversight of critical functions. Major companies operating in the market launch semi-autonomous drones to enhance military capabilities and propel segmental growth. For instance, in 2023, General Atomics announced upgrades to the MQ-9 Reaper, incorporating semi-autonomous navigation and target recognition capabilities to enhance mission effectiveness and reduce pilot workload. Additionally, in August 2022, BAE Systems developed a semi-autonomous swarm technology for its MANTIS UAV, enabling coordinated operations in complex environments through AI-driven decision-making support.

Based on application, the drone warfare market is segmented into combat, delivery and transportation, intelligence, surveillance, reconnaissance, and others. The combat segment has dominated the market in the historic year and is expected to dominate in the forecast period. The major factors contributing to the segmental growth include the evolving nature of warfare, reduced risk to personnel, increasing geopolitical tension between countries, and growing technological advancements. The ongoing technological advances such as the integration of AI, sensor technology, and communication systems have persistently enhanced the capabilities of drones. Furthermore, the growing demand for less logistics and transportation has further impeded the growth of the market, compared to traditional combat aircraft. This further helps in deploying drones in remote areas or austere environments. For instance, in June 2023, General Atomics unveiled the MQ-9B SkyGuardian, equipped with advanced combat capabilities, including precision-guided munitions and AI-powered targeting systems for enhanced operational effectiveness.

For a better understanding of the drone warfare market, the market is analyzed based on its worldwide presence in countries such as North America (The US, Canada, and Rest of North America), Europe (Germany, The UK, France, Italy, Spain, Rest of Europe), Asia-Pacific (China, Japan, India, Rest of Asia-Pacific), Rest of World. The North America drone warfare market currently dominates and is expected to dominate in the forecasted period due to several factors, such as the growing technological advancements in drones, and increased demand for security and surveillance. North America is the home to the world's biggest drone manufacturers specializing in making military drones. Companies such as Northrop Grumman, General Atomics, BAE systems, and others have heavily invested in military drones. Moreover, governments in the region are flourishing favorable policies for the deployment of military drones to safeguard their borders. Moreover, collaboration between companies and governments is accelerating innovation in the military drone market in the region. Furthermore, the increasing defense budget in the region has grown which leads to allocating substantial funds in the drone space that enhances surveillance and reconnaissance. For instance, in September 2022, Lockheed Martin invested USD 100 million of its own money to develop a sophisticated manned-unmanned teaming capability involving F-35 fighter jets and combat drones.

Some of the major players operating in the market include Northrop Grumman Corporation, Boeing, Raytheon Technologies Corporation, Israel Aerospace Industries Ltd., General Atomics, Teledyne FLIR LLC, Airbus SE, Lockheed Martin Corporation, BAE Systems, and Elbit Systems Ltd.
